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Little Pied Bat | Moore's woolly lemur |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(प्राणी) | Animalia (प्राणी)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(रज्जुकी) | Chordata (रज्जुकी) |
| Class same | Mammalia (स्तनधारी) | Mammalia (स्तनधारी) |
| Order | Chiroptera (चमगादड़) | Primates (नरवानर गण) |
| Family | Vespertilionidae | Indriidae |
| Genus | Chalinolobus | Avahi |
| Species | Chalinolobus picatus | Avahi mooreorum |
Evolutionary Relationship
Little Pied Bat and Moore's woolly lemur share a common ancestor at the Class level: Mammalia. (स्तनधारी)
